Successful-efforts Method
An accounting method used in the oil and gas industry focusing on capitalizing the cost of successful projects and expensing those of unsuccessful ones.
Full-cost Method
An accounting method where all direct and indirect costs of producing an asset are capitalized or included in its cost base.
Drilling Expense
Costs associated with the process of drilling, such as those incurred in the exploration and production of oil and gas resources.
